Transaction 33ad75ec98f3d793f5713c767a19d194a25a023dd9b7caf8ec28caad5ce75025

1 Input
1 Outputs
  • 33ad75ec98f3d793f5713c767a19d194a25a023dd9b7caf8ec28caad5ce75025:0
  • value  46167
    address  3CZY79wMQbfaAhAcBwhenc7AeLQYUfiqFk